Suspension wear often begins subtly. A slightly softer feel over bumps, minor vibrations in the steering wheel, or uneven tire wear may seem insignificant at first. Left unchecked, these early warning signs can lead to more serious issues, affecting ride quality, handling, and even safety. Detecting problems early protects your investment, maintains performance, and prevents costly repairs.

Suspension issues rarely appear overnight. Most problems develop gradually and are noticeable only through careful observation or a trained eye.
Uneven or Rapid Tire Wear – Scalloped, cupped, or uneven tread patterns often indicate worn suspension components or misalignment. A Porsche or BMW may feel smooth, but the tires can reveal hidden problems affecting handling.
Excessive Bouncing or Poor Handling – If your car bounces more than usual over bumps or feels unstable in turns, shocks or struts may be worn. Vehicles with adaptive dampers may amplify these sensations when sensors detect uneven performance.
Steering Vibrations or Pulling – Vibrations in the steering wheel or a subtle pull to one side often indicate worn control arms, bushings, or tie rods. Early detection prevents alignment or drivetrain damage.
Strange Noises Over Bumps – Clunks, squeaks, or rattles when driving over bumps can point to failing sway bars, loose mounts, or worn suspension joints. European vehicles, especially Volkswagen, Audi, and Land Rover, may transmit subtle noises from electronic or adaptive suspension systems.
Sagging or Uneven Ride Height – A lowered corner or uneven ride can indicate spring fatigue or component damage. Even minor ride height changes affect handling and stability.
